Enhancing Active Shooter Response

Chris Grollnek is a retired McKinney, Texas, police officer and a


former member of the United States Marine Corps. During his 10-
year career as a police officer, Chris Grollnek served on the
S.W.A.T. Team and held other positions, including Advanced
Tactics Instructor and Team Firearms Trainer. He is the founder
of Countermeasure Consulting Group, LLC, and is a leading
authority on the active shooter. He has appeared on numerous
networks, including CNN.

An active shooter is an individual who opens fire on innocent
victims. Mass shootings are one of the most steadily increasing
crimes, and these episodes continue to become more deadly.
According to experts on active shooters, effectively dealing with
these situations requires all law enforcement officers to receive
the proper training and equipment.

In order to meet this demand, the J ustice Department has teamed
up with private contractors such as Countermeasure Consulting
Group to provide officials with active shooter training. More than
50,000 front-line law enforcement officials and 7,000 commanders
throughout state and federal agencies have now received
specialized training on active shooter response.
